A Fairy Tale Of a Different Kind::
Once Upon a time, in a land of survival, there lived a man named Francisco. We came across him one day as he was busy building a castle for his queen. With many hours of scrounging and sheer determination,his labor of love began to take shape but construction came to a halt when it came to pouring the concrete floor. He had overcome incredible odds, but one thing he couldn't conquer was the few pesos it would take to buy the supplies for this phase of his dream.

The Three Amigos:
Meet Francisco, Edwardo, and Giovanni.These 3 guys had recently 'aged-out' of one of the local orphanages and are trying to carve out a life for themselves with not much more than the clothes they are wearing. Rick & Lisa have begun to take them under their wing and try to mentor them in this part of their journey.

Update from Special Agent Pauls - 03.02.12
Hola!!
It has been completely 'loco' down here in the sunny south!!
Let me fill you in. The team from Napanee left Wednesday :( We will miss them greatly. This team was incredible!! They really came to pour into the people. They built a laundry room at the orphanage, finished painting the front wall of the orphanage, brought mattress covers for all of out mattresses, and brought TONS of donations and fun things for the orphanage and the kids in the community. One of the days that they were with us, we went to visit the children at Bethany orphanage. It was so cool to see how another orphanage is run and be able to play and enjoy the kids.

Judgement Calls
Yesterday we visited a house by the river that had been impacted by the hurricane. The mattresses they were using they had found in the riverbed after the flood. As I stood there I was dealing with so much inner conflict. You see, on one hand I wanted to get a dream together and get mattresses sponsored, but then I looked around and saw the garbage laying everywhere. I mean everywhere. I did not even take pictures it was that nasty. How much energy does it take to clean garbage in and around your own home? You see my dilemma? Can you sense my conflict? I wanted to help but they were not even interested in helping themselves. So I am interested....what would you do? I am truly interested. Why not make a comment.
